South Korea Construction Project Estimating Software Market By Type Segment Analysis

The South Korea construction project estimating software market is primarily segmented into traditional desktop-based solutions, cloud-based platforms, and integrated enterprise systems. Traditional desktop solutions, characterized by on-premise deployment, have historically dominated the market due to their early adoption and data security perceptions. However, the rapid digital transformation and increasing demand for real-time data access have accelerated the shift towards cloud-based estimating platforms, which offer scalability, remote collaboration, and lower upfront costs. The integrated enterprise systems combine estimating functionalities with project management, procurement, and accounting modules, providing comprehensive solutions for large-scale construction firms. Market size estimates suggest that cloud-based estimating software accounts for approximately 45% of the total market, with traditional desktop solutions comprising around 35%, and integrated enterprise systems capturing the remaining 20%. Over the next 5–10 years, the cloud segment is projected to grow at a CAGR of approximately 12%, driven by technological advancements and evolving client preferences.

The fastest-growing segment within this landscape is the cloud-based construction estimating software, which is currently in the growth stage, transitioning from emerging adoption to mainstream acceptance. Key growth accelerators include the increasing adoption of Building Information Modeling (BIM), the need for integrated project workflows, and the rising importance of data-driven decision-making. Technological innovations such as AI-driven cost estimation, machine learning algorithms, and mobile-enabled platforms are further propelling this segment’s expansion. Mature markets with high digital readiness are rapidly adopting these solutions, while smaller firms are increasingly recognizing the cost and efficiency benefits. The integration of IoT and real-time data analytics is expected to further disrupt traditional estimation processes, making cloud solutions indispensable for future growth.

Technological Disruption & Innovation in South Korea Construction Project Estimating Software Market

Emerging technologies are revolutionizing the South Korea construction estimating landscape, with AI and machine learning leading the charge. These innovations enable predictive cost modeling, real-time data integration, and enhanced accuracy, reducing human error and project delays. Cloud computing facilitates seamless collaboration among stakeholders across geographies, fostering transparency and efficiency.

Furthermore, the integration of BIM with estimating software is transforming traditional workflows, allowing for more precise material and labor cost calculations. Augmented reality (AR) and virtual reality (VR) are also beginning to influence project visualization and planning, providing immersive environments for better estimation accuracy. These technological disruptions are setting new standards for productivity and competitiveness in South Korea’s construction sector.

Emerging Business Models in South Korea Construction Project Estimating Software Market

Subscription-based SaaS models are gaining popularity, offering scalability and lower upfront costs for construction firms. Hybrid models combining on-premise and cloud solutions are also emerging, catering to clients with specific data security needs. Additionally, platform-as-a-service (PaaS) offerings enable customization and integration with existing enterprise systems.

Partnerships between software providers and construction technology firms are fostering co-innovation, while pay-per-use models are attracting small to mid-sized firms seeking cost-effective solutions. The shift towards integrated project delivery models emphasizes the need for comprehensive, end-to-end estimating platforms that can adapt to evolving project complexities.
